What the FDA labels say

From the Aripiprazole (ABILIFY MAINTENA) label · effective 2026-03-24

Major

CYP3A4 Inducers : Avoid concomitant use for greater than 14 days ( 7.1 )

Avoid use of ABILIFY MAINTENA in combination with carbamazepine and other inducers of CYP3A4 for greater than 14 days [see Dosage and Administration (2.4) ] .

Strong CYP3A4 Inducers (e.g., carbamazepine) The concomitant use of oral aripiprazole and carbamazepine decreased the exposure of aripiprazole [see Clinical Pharmacology (12.3) ].
